Transaction 188090099ac2b037b6ffff404b6b74ee1199e01a79ecf49941c4757146e2190f

1 Input
2 Outputs
  • 188090099ac2b037b6ffff404b6b74ee1199e01a79ecf49941c4757146e2190f:0
  • value  5074164
    address  17aQKQv2zasEwgASmqUcWy9v2RAXQChKnT
  • 188090099ac2b037b6ffff404b6b74ee1199e01a79ecf49941c4757146e2190f:1
  • value  661344569
    address  3PLUwEpW3W3hDeSFHCHvFByx2N4tRPGRZv